>On 10:49 pm 04/25/07 "Lance LaPrarie" <sciroccojunky@gmail.com> wrote:
>> The shop that did my headliner was able to source one from a joint in
>> Florida. Hope you're sitting down though. It was $275. Part number is
>> 533 845 121A
>>
>> ETKA shows it dropped in 05 though. I know you can find one but it
>> will be about as much as the glass. To get the glass out without
>> breaking it is by cuttting your existing seal.
